Output 71421dafdae1c5c1a2b3c148560c7d802e8dfcaf1ef02dff4c6926b5ab96c4aa:0

value
587943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c26fd192adaacfa6c8848de290b9138a6317a81 OP_EQUAL
address
3Jqsfb3hsD5jtexvr8CJyN3Qf7ZLnbn2bQ
transaction
71421dafdae1c5c1a2b3c148560c7d802e8dfcaf1ef02dff4c6926b5ab96c4aa
spent
true